1. What is a Volume by Volume Calculator?

Definition: This calculator determines the volume fraction (φ) which represents the ratio of a component's volume to the total volume.

Purpose: It's used in material science, chemistry, engineering, and other fields to quantify the proportion of a component within a mixture.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 \phi = \frac{V_{component}}{V_{total}} \]

Where:

Explanation: The component volume is divided by the total volume to get the volume fraction, which ranges from 0 to 1.

3. Importance of Volume Fraction Calculation

Details: Volume fraction is crucial for determining material properties, mixture ratios, porosity, and phase distributions in composite materials.

5. Frequently Asked Questions (FAQ)

Q1: What units should I use?
A: Any volume units can be used (liters, cubic meters, gallons, etc.) as long as both inputs use the same units.

Q2: How is volume fraction different from volume percent?
A: Volume fraction ranges 0-1, while volume percent is simply φ × 100 and ranges 0-100%.

Q3: What does a volume fraction of 0.5 mean?
A: It means the component makes up 50% of the total volume (half of the space).

Q4: Can volume fraction be greater than 1?
A: No, by definition it cannot exceed 1, as the component cannot occupy more space than the total volume.

Q5: What are some practical applications?
A: Used in alloy composition, polymer blends, porosity calculations, fuel mixtures, and many material science applications.
